舞蹈编程脚本编写指南366


引言

舞蹈编程脚本是用于编排和控制虚拟舞者的代码,它使动画师能够创建复杂的舞蹈动作。了解如何编写舞蹈编程脚本对于创建逼真的舞蹈动画至关重要。本文将提供一个分步指南,介绍舞蹈编程脚本的基本概念、语法和最佳实践。

基本语法

舞蹈编程脚本通常使用基于文本的语言,具有以下基本语法:
变量:用于存储数据,如关节角度或位置。
函数:用于执行特定操作,如移动关节或设置动画速度。
条件语句:用于根据特定条件做出决策,如是否执行某个动作。
循环:用于重复执行代码块。

编写步骤

要编写舞蹈编程脚本,请遵循以下步骤:
规划舞蹈动作:确定舞蹈动作、顺序和持续时间。
创建角色模型:建立虚拟舞者的骨架和网格。
设置动画系统:选择一个用于控制舞者运动的动画系统。
编写脚本:使用语法编写脚本以控制舞者的运动、动画和条件。
预览和调试:运行脚本并检查舞者的运动以进行调整和调试。

最佳实践

为了编写有效的舞蹈编程脚本,请遵循以下最佳实践:
分层结构:使用分层结构来组织脚本,以便轻松管理和重用代码。
可读性:使用清晰的变量名称和注释来使脚本易于阅读和理解。
优化效率:避免不必要的循环和条件语句以提高脚本效率。
使用工具:利用脚本编辑器和调试工具来简化脚本编写流程。
测试和迭代:经常测试脚本并进行迭代以改进舞者的运动和动画效果。

示例脚本

以下是一个简单的舞蹈编程脚本示例,用于创建手臂摆动动作:
```
// 变量
angle = 0;
speed = 10;
// 函数
moveArm() {
// 移动关节
angle += speed;
= angle;
}
// 循环
while (true) {
// 执行手臂摆动
moveArm();
// 等待一段时间
wait(10);
}
```

结论

通过了解舞蹈编程脚本的基本概念、语法和最佳实践,您可以创建逼真的舞蹈动画。遵循分步指南、遵循最佳实践并利用示例可以帮助您编写有效的舞蹈编程脚本。通过实践和迭代,您可以掌握这项技能并制作出色的舞蹈动画。

2025-02-09


上一篇:入门脚本编程教程视频

下一篇:脚本编辑中的编程世界